Beer not fermenting?

So we made like our fourth batch of all grain beer last week (the 30th) and our first attempt at a lager, marzen. Everything went incredibly well presumably except that now, a week later, it appears that the beer has not fermented. This is not confirmed, but there is no kreuzen and no evidence as we have seen in the past of an active fermentation. I'm going to check the gravity tomorrow to see if there has been any change, but, in my heart of hearts, I really think we've got a dud on our…See More

Ray Grace replied to Outsider's Almanac's discussion 'Adjustments for 2Hearted Clone to Avoid Over Carbonation?'
You shouldn't have any problems as long as you allow it to fully attenuate. Assuming you've allowed the yeast to consume all the sugars in your wort, the only sugars available during priming will be from the priming sugar.
